![In comparing tlie birth-rate of Torquay with other towns, we must bear in mind the constitution of the population. Here we have a large excess of females over males, a large proportion of the females are spinsters, and some 40 are either above or below the child-bearing age. In the face of such facts, it is unreasonable to expect anything but a low birth-rate. In my last two reports I have drawn attention to the great increase in the number of exemptions from vaccination granted.
